Udostępnij za pośrednictwem


Migrowanie pul Azure Batch do uproszczonego modelu komunikacji węzła obliczeniowego

Aby zwiększyć bezpieczeństwo, uprościć środowisko użytkownika i włączyć kluczowe przyszłe ulepszenia, Azure Batch wycofa klasyczny model komunikacji węzła obliczeniowego 31 marca 2026 r. Dowiedz się, jak przeprowadzić migrację pul usługi Batch do korzystania z uproszczonego modelu komunikacji węzła obliczeniowego.

Informacje o funkcji

Pula Azure Batch zawiera co najmniej jeden węzeł obliczeniowy, który wykonuje obciążenia określone przez użytkownika w postaci zadań podrzędnych usługi Batch. Aby włączyć funkcje usługi Batch i zarządzanie infrastrukturą puli usługi Batch, węzły obliczeniowe muszą komunikować się z usługą Azure Batch. W klasycznym modelu komunikacji węzła obliczeniowego usługa Batch inicjuje komunikację z węzłami obliczeniowymi, a węzły obliczeniowe muszą mieć możliwość komunikowania się z usługą Azure Storage na potrzeby operacji bazowych. W uproszczonym modelu komunikacji węzła obliczeniowego pule usługi Batch wymagają tylko dostępu wychodzącego do usługi Batch na potrzeby operacji bazowych.

Koniec wsparcia funkcji

Uproszczony model komunikacji węzła obliczeniowego zastąpi klasyczny model komunikacji węzła obliczeniowego po 31 marca 2026 r. Zmiana jest wprowadzana w dwóch fazach:

  • Od teraz do 30 września 2024 r. domyślny tryb komunikacji węzłów dla nowo utworzonych pul usługi Batch z sieciami wirtualnymi pozostanie klasyczny.
  • Po 30 września 2024 r. domyślny tryb komunikacji węzłów dla nowo utworzonych pul usługi Batch z sieciami wirtualnymi zmieni się na uproszczony.

Po 31 marca 2026 r. opcja korzystania z klasycznego trybu komunikacji węzła obliczeniowego nie będzie już honorowana. Ta zmiana nie ma wpływu na pule usługi Batch bez określonych przez użytkownika sieci wirtualnych, a usługa Batch kontroluje domyślny tryb komunikacji.

Alternatywna: użyj uproszczonego modelu komunikacji węzła obliczeniowego

Uproszczony tryb komunikacji węzła obliczeniowego usprawnia sposób zarządzania infrastrukturą puli usługi Batch w imieniu użytkowników. Ten tryb komunikacji zmniejsza złożoność i zakres przychodzących i wychodzących połączeń sieciowych wymaganych w operacjach bazowych.

Uproszczony model zapewnia również bardziej szczegółową kontrolę eksfiltracji danych, ponieważ komunikacja wychodząca z usługą Storage.region nie jest już wymagana. W razie potrzeby możesz jawnie zablokować komunikację wychodzącą do usługi Azure Storage. Na przykład konta automatycznego tworzenia magazynu dla pakietu AppPackage i innych kont magazynu dla plików zasobów lub plików wyjściowych można odpowiednio określić zakres.

Migrowanie kwalifikujących się pul

Aby przeprowadzić migrację pul usługi Batch z modelu klasycznego do uproszczonego modelu komunikacji węzła obliczeniowego, postępuj zgodnie z tym dokumentem z sekcji zatytułowanej potencjalny wpływ między klasycznymi i uproszczonymi trybami komunikacji. Możesz utworzyć nowe pule lub zaktualizować istniejące pule przy użyciu uproszczonej komunikacji węzła obliczeniowego.

Często zadawane pytania

  • Czy publiczne adresy IP są nadal wymagane dla moich pul?

    Domyślnie publiczny adres IP jest nadal potrzebny do zainicjowania połączenia wychodzącego z usługą Azure Batch z węzłów obliczeniowych. Jeśli chcesz całkowicie wyeliminować konieczność korzystania z publicznych adresów IP z węzłów obliczeniowych, zobacz przewodnik dotyczący tworzenia uproszczonej puli komunikacji węzłów bez publicznych adresów IP

  • Jak połączyć się z węzłami w celach diagnostycznych?

    Nie ma to wpływu na łączność RDP lub SSH z węzłem — moduły równoważenia obciążenia są nadal tworzone, co umożliwia kierowanie tych żądań do węzła po aprowizacji przy użyciu publicznego adresu IP.

  • Czy istnieją różnice w rozliczeniach?

    Nie powinno być żadnych kosztów ani konsekwencji rozliczeniowych dla nowego modelu.

  • Czy istnieją zmiany dotyczące agentów Azure Batch w węźle obliczeniowym?

    Dodatkowy agent w węzłach obliczeniowych jest wywoływany w uproszczonym trybie komunikacji węzłów obliczeniowych dla systemów Linux i Windows Microsoft.BatchClusters.Agent oraz Microsoft.BatchClusters.Agent.exe, odpowiednio.

  • Czy w pulach i zadaniach usługi Batch są pobierane jakieś zmiany dotyczące sposobu pobierania połączonych zasobów z usługi Azure Storage?

    To zachowanie nie ma wpływu — wszystkie zasoby określone przez użytkownika, które wymagają usługi Azure Storage, takie jak pliki zasobów, pliki wyjściowe lub pakiety aplikacji, są tworzone z węzła obliczeniowego bezpośrednio do usługi Azure Storage. Należy upewnić się, że konfiguracja sieci zezwala na te przepływy.

Następne kroki

Aby uzyskać więcej informacji, zobacz Uproszczona komunikacja węzła obliczeniowego.